Which Wich - Buffalo Chicken - Super has a average-calorie, low-carb, average-fat and very high-protein content.
The food contains 6g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its low sugar content puts it in the bottom 20 percentile. This is a good thing for people watching their sugar intake. With 36 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Because of its average f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is average in saturated fats and low in trans fats. It's low MUFA and low P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the bottom 20% of all food items. It is also ranked in the bottom 20 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".
It has a very high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et.

Serving size
Amount Per Serving
Calories 200 Calories from Fat 50
% Daily Value *
Total Fat 5 g 7.7%
Saturated Fat 2 g 10%
Trans Fat 0 g
Cholesterol 110 mg 36.7%
Sodium 3740 mg 155.8%
Total Carbohydrates 6 g 2%
Dietary Fiber 0 g
Sugars 0 g
Protein 36 g 72%
Vitamin A Vitamin C
Calcium Iron
*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
